Loaded Cheesy Philly Steak Sandwich πŸ§€πŸ₯–πŸ”₯

Ingredients:

  • 1 baguette or hoagie rolls
  • 300g ground beef (or thinly sliced steak)
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 onion (thinly sliced)
  • 1/2 green bell pepper (optional)
  • 2 slices cheddar cheese (or cheese sauce)
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• Salt & black pepper to taste
  • 1/2 tsp paprika
  • 1 tbsp butter (for toasting bread)

Instructions:

  1. Heat olive oil in a pan over medium heat.
  2. Add onions and cook slowly until soft and caramelized.
  3. Add garlic and cook for 1 minute.
  4. Add the ground beef (or steak), season with salt, pepper, and paprika. Cook until browned.
  5. Mix the onions with the meat and let everything cook together for extra flavor.
  6. Slice the bread and toast it with butter until golden and crispy.
  7. Fill the bread with the hot beef mixture.
  8. Add cheese on top and let it melt (you can cover the pan for 1–2 minutes).
  9. Serve hot while the cheese is still gooey and melted.

Pro Tip:
Add a little mayo or mustard sauce inside the bread for extra flavorβ€”and if you want it more authentic, use provolone cheese instead of cheddar
